Dear Experts;

I've a wage type that should be paid based on the Marital Status and another one that should be paid on the address. If the employee lives in a place and went to another region this wage type should be paid based on a specific percentage from another wage type.

For the first wage type I've tried to use the valuation basis based on master data. I've selected the wage type and entered Infotype Personal Data and selected the Marital Status field and in the "Char.str.value" I've added "1" for Married, and in the amount I've added the required amount.

In the Wage type characteristics I've selected ICOMP as was mentioned in the documentation of the Indirect Valuation based on Master data.

But whenever I hire an employee and select that this employee is Married then go to Infotype 8 and enter the payroll data that wage type doesn't come automatically, even if I selected the wage type it doesn't show me the amount recorded in the configuration. The same thing happens with the wage type selected for the address.

Can anyone guide me if there is something missing.

Infotype / SType / IT field 0002 / / FAMST

Calc.ind. / Comp.ind. / EQ Char.str.value 1
